This Bellingham Handpicked Viognier is part of the Bellingham The Bernard Series, a tribute to founder Bernard Podlahuk. This visionary man did everything to make South Africa a wine region, also known as 'The Maverick winemaker'. He was never satisfied with a medium level product but always wanted the best. A visionary and innovative man, something that comes forward in this wine. The Viognier grapes for this wine come from a 16 years old vineyard, located at the foot of mount Perdeberg in Agter-Paarl. The soil mainly consists of weathered granite and the vineyard brings only 5 tons of ruit. The grapes are handpicked and once vinified 50% of them is matured in French oak casks. The other 50% matures in tanks and before the wine is blended it matures (together) on the dregs for about 8 months.
The result is a clear and golden wine with a young green reflection. Very rich with peach and white pears, spices and honey aromas. The finish is refreshing and fruity with hints of vanilla. A perfect companion of spicy fusion dishes like pork wontons, five spices steak, honey roasted duck or a curry. It has an aging potential of about 5 years.
